DB2 Database Administrator (OBA) with proven experience supporting D82 v12 (or higher) on an IBM zJOS platform. Primary responsibilities include working with application development teams to install and migrate releases, support execution of data fixes, define new and execute databases recovery functions, definition and execution of standard database tuning procedures (e.g., runstats, reorgs).
Primary Responsibilities:
• Ensure that all installation, configuration, and tuning of DB2 databases are completed efficiently.
• Author and validate procedures for all database processes.
• Identify potential issues and deliver modifications I updates for DB2 programs. • Communicate with and deliver to Tech Support all elements to be migrated with specific instructions to be performed during the production migration.
• Assist Systems areas with tool upgrades and participate in Disaster Recovery drills.
• Define and execute databases recovery functions, definition and execution of standard database tuning procedures (e.g., runstats, reorgs).
• Monitor the health of the key database operations (backup/ recovery processes, logging, system response times, etc).
• Open and manage tickets logged with IBM to resolution.
• Work with application development teams to install and migrate software releases (DB2 tasks) and support execution of data fixes (backups, packaging for production, etc).
• Perform DB2 DB troubleshooting of online and batch programs during production, user acceptance testing, integrated system testing, performance testing and development phases of the work effort.
• Design and execute technical tests to ensure that vendor and FISA software deliveries address the business and technical problems in a manner consistent with FISA standards for quality and completeness.
• Perform the all system administration activities for the IBM lnfoSphere Data Replication product. High availability of the product is required, as it is a critical part of the City''s Financial Management System.
